Pool automation systems bring enhanced convenience and control to maintaining your pool. Using your smartphone or tablet, you can oversee all pool functions, from setting the temperature to adjusting the lighting.
- Remote Control and Monitoring: An important aspect of automated pool systems is the ability to monitor and manage your pool remotely. Whether you are nearby or far away, you can connect to your pool's system via a mobile app. This allows you to make adjustments on the fly, ensuring your pool is always ready for use.
- Automated Chemical Management: Maintaining the correct chemical balance is crucial for a healthy pool. Pool automation systems offer automated chemical balancing that regulate chemical levels automatically. Sensors in the system constantly measure pH, chlorine, and alkalinity, adjusting levels as required. This maintains safe swimming conditions but also reduces the need for manual testing and adjustments.
Energy Efficiency and Cost SavingsSmart pool automation are designed to optimize energy use, yielding significant savings on energy costs.
- Scheduled Operations: With automation, you can schedule operations for your pool equipment during energy-efficient times, such as running the pump or heater when energy costs are lower. This strategic scheduling helps lower your energy consumption and lowers your expenses.
- Optimized Equipment Use: Smart pool automation also manage your pool’s equipment more efficiently. Variable-speed pumps, for instance, can be adjusted to run at lower speeds when full power is not needed, drastically cutting energy use. Automated heating systems can keep a steady temperature, only activating the heater when needed, further saving on energy costs.
Improved Safety FeaturesSafety is a top priority for anyone with a pool, and smart pool automation increase safety with various advanced features.
- Automated Safety Alerts: Smart pool systems can issue notifications if they detect any issues. For instance, if chemical levels are out of balance, you will be alerted right away. Similarly, if there is an equipment malfunction, you will receive an instant notification. This allows for quick action to resolve the problem, preventing potential damage or unsafe conditions.
- Connecting to Safety Equipment: Pool automation systems can connect with different safety devices, such as pool covers, fences, and alarms. Automated pool covers can be programmed to close when the pool is unattended, stopping unauthorized entry and reducing water loss. Safety alarms and sensors can warn you of unauthorized pool entry, increasing the security and safety around your pool.
